Optimization of a heterogeneous Pd-Cu/zeolite Y Wacker catalyst for ethylene oxidation.
Chemical Communications ( IF 4.9 ) Pub Date : 2020-01-07 , DOI: 10.1039/c9cc08835k
Jerick Imbao 1 , Jeroen A van Bokhoven , Maarten Nachtegaal
Affiliation  

Exchanging low amounts of palladium with excess copper in a heterogeneous zeolite Y catalyst leads to high Wacker activity and mitigates activity loss by reducing the extent of palladium sintering. Employing periodic regenerative treatments in oxygen to remove carbon deposits and reoxidize palladium results in the partial (but reversible) recovery of the high initial activity.
